Australia Day Breakfast and Activities Tennant Creek

Take part and help celebrate Australia’s very own special day.

On 26 January the nation celebrates what's great about being Australian with official and formal functions as well as fun activities with family and friends.

The 'Golden Heart' town of Tennant Creek celebrates all day long. Kicking off early the official flag raising and the National Anthem paves the way to an outback 'Aussie breakfast'. Afterwards, head out to the Mary Ann Dam Recreational Lake for very Australian activities like egg catching, sack races and thong throwing. The highlight of the day is a raft race on the lake. After the Barkly Triathlon you'll smell the food cooking on the barbecue and realise you have worked up an appetite once more, it's free so enjoy.
